1

Golang Backend Developer Jobs (NOW HIRING)

* Demonstrable experience in at least one backend type safe programming language Golang Preferred * Comfortable experience with backend microservice architecture and communication specifically REST and ...

Demonstrable experience in at least one back-end type safe programming language Golang Preferred but other experience can be considered. * Comfortable experience with back end micro service ...

We are seeking a Software Engineer with 5+ years of overall experience and a minimum of 2 years experience using Golang to design, develop, and maintain scalable backend systems. * In this role, you ...

Remote or Hybrid in Plano, TX (Dallas) Duration: 1 year open-ended Contract We are looking for a talented Go [Golang] backend software developer/engineer who will be a crucial part of our software ...

Sr Software Engineer (Level IV) Primary duties will focus on backend system design, development, and deployment using Golang, MySQL, Docker, and AWS. Responsibilities: * Design and develop scalable ...

Build and maintain backend services and APIs using Go (Golang) * HL7 or FHIR (Only both found in healthcare) * Understanding of APIs, RESTful services, and database interactions Backend developers:

They are seeking a Backend Developer to design, develop, test, and maintain scalable backend ... Required : • 10+ Year Experience • Python • Nodejs • TypeScript • Java • Golang • ...

FHIR Backend Developers- 8 Openings Location: 100% Remote Length: 12-months Must Haves: 3-5 years of hands-on Golang Build and maintain backend services and APIs using Go (Golang HL7 or FHIR(Only ...

Golang Developer Location: Atlanta, GA Duration: 6+ months Note: Local profiles are highly ... Design, develop, and maintain backend services using Go (Golang) * Build and consume RESTful APIs ...

Java Backend Developer

Manhattan, NY · On-site

$55.75 - $72.25/hr

Java Backend Developer Location- New-York City, NY (3 days hybrid) Employment Type: Contract GC-EAD ... GoLang exposure. * Financial Services or Banking domain experience.

Senior Backend Developer

$123K - $160K/yr

Senior Backend Developer We are looking for a full-time senior Golang developer that can help us to improve and extend our data processing backend and make it easy for organizations to protect their ...

next page

Showing results 1-20

Golang Backend Developer information

See salary details

$12

$57

$84

How much do golang backend developer jobs pay per hour?

As of Jul 4, 2026, the average hourly pay for golang backend developer in the United States is $57.73, according to ZipRecruiter salary data. Most workers in this role earn between $47.36 and $68.27 per hour, depending on experience, location, and employer.

What engineer makes $500,000 a year?

Senior software engineers, especially those with expertise in high-demand areas like backend development, cloud computing, or specialized skills such as Golang, can earn $500,000 or more annually in large tech companies or through executive roles. Achieving this level typically requires extensive experience, advanced skills, and often leadership responsibilities or equity compensation.

Can Golang be used for backend development?

Golang is widely used for backend development due to its simplicity, performance, and concurrency support. Many backend developers use Go to build scalable, efficient server-side applications and microservices, often leveraging its standard library and tools like Docker for deployment.

Are Golang developers in demand?

Golang developers are in high demand due to the language's efficiency, concurrency support, and use in cloud infrastructure, microservices, and backend systems. Companies value skills in Go for building scalable, high-performance applications, leading to strong job growth in this field.

What is the difference between Golang Backend Developer vs Python Backend Developer?

AspectGolang Backend DeveloperPython Backend Developer
Required CredentialsBachelor's in CS or related field; familiarity with GoBachelor's in CS or related field; proficiency in Python
Work EnvironmentBackend development, microservices, cloud platformsBackend development, web applications, data processing
Employer & Industry UsageTech companies, startups, cloud servicesWeb development, data science, startups
Common Search & ComparisonYesYes

Golang Backend Developers focus on high-performance, concurrent backend systems using Go, often in cloud and microservices environments. Python Backend Developers work on web applications and data processing with Python, which is versatile and widely used across industries. Both roles require similar educational backgrounds but differ in language expertise and typical project focus.

What does a Golang Backend Developer do?

A Golang Backend Developer is responsible for designing, building, and maintaining server-side applications using the Go programming language. They work on the logic, databases, APIs, and other components that power web and mobile applications. Their role involves optimizing performance, ensuring scalability, and integrating third-party services. They often collaborate with frontend developers, DevOps engineers, and product teams to deliver robust software solutions.

What are the key skills and qualifications needed to thrive as a Golang Backend Developer, and why are they important?

To thrive as a Golang Backend Developer, you need strong proficiency in Go programming, a solid understanding of backend architecture, and experience with RESTful APIs and databases. Familiarity with tools like Docker, Kubernetes, version control systems (e.g., Git), and cloud platforms (such as AWS or GCP) is commonly required, as well as relevant certifications in cloud or backend development. Problem-solving abilities, effective communication, and a collaborative mindset are essential soft skills for this role. These skills ensure the efficient development, deployment, and maintenance of scalable, reliable backend systems that support business needs.

What is the salary of backend engineer Golang?

The salary of a Golang backend developer varies based on experience, location, and company size, but typically ranges from $80,000 to $150,000 annually in many markets. Skilled developers with expertise in concurrent programming, RESTful APIs, and cloud deployment can command higher salaries, especially in competitive tech hubs.

What are some common challenges Golang Backend Developers face when working on large-scale distributed systems?

Golang Backend Developers often encounter challenges related to concurrency management, debugging complex distributed processes, and ensuring efficient communication between microservices. Handling data consistency and managing resource usage across multiple services can also be demanding. Collaborating closely with DevOps and frontend teams is crucial to ensure seamless integration, scalability, and reliability in production environments.
More about Golang Backend Developer jobs
What cities are hiring for Golang Backend Developer jobs? Cities with the most Golang Backend Developer job openings:
What are the most commonly searched types of Golang Backend Developer jobs? The most popular types of Golang Backend Developer jobs are:
What states have the most Golang Backend Developer jobs? States with the most job openings for Golang Backend Developer jobs include:
What job categories do people searching Golang Backend Developer jobs look for? The top searched job categories for Golang Backend Developer jobs are:
Infographic showing various Golang Backend Developer job openings in the United States as of June 2026, with employment types broken down into 72% Full Time, 4% Part Time, and 24% Contract. Highlights an 79% Physical, 5% Hybrid, and 16% Remote job distribution, with an average salary of $120,086 per year, or $57.7 per hour.

Other

Posted 11 days ago


Job description

Job Description:
  • Demonstrable experience in at least one backend type safe programming language Golang Preferred
  • Comfortable experience with backend microservice architecture and communication specifically REST and asynchronous messaging services eg Kafka RabbitMQ etc
  • Comfortable experience within a Scrum framework working with as part of a team to deliver business functions and customer journeys that are tested and automated throughout the CICD pipeline to production
  • Bachelor's degree in computer science computer engineering or other technical discipline or equivalent work experience
  • Experience in professional software development
  • Solid understanding of test-driven development including unit component functional system integration and regression tests
  • Knowledge of software engineering methodology Agile incl Scrum Kanban SAFe TestDriven Development TDD Behavior Driven Development BDD and Waterfall
  • Knowledge of any or all the following technologies is desired Kafka Postgres Golang Git gRPC Docker GraphQL
  • Experienced in continuous integration CI continuous deployment CD and continuous testing CT including tools such as Jenkins Rally and/or JIRA and version control such as GIT or SVN

Skills
Mandatory Skills : Golang